WebCryptozoology is the study of reports of creatures (or apparent creatures) whose descriptions suggest something other than animals classified by standard biology as extant. But biology textbooks list pterosaurs as long-extinct, so why give reports of living creatures credence? Part of the answer is that cryptozoology is not a branch of zoology. Webr/Cryptozoology • The "Chupacabra Effect" is when people who sight an unknown animal label the creature as a local cryptid, even if the unknown animal has little in common with it. The International Society of Cryptozoology (ISC) was founded in 1982 at a special meeting hosted by the Department of Vertebrate Zoology of the U.S. National Museum of Natural History, Smithsonian Institution, Washington, D.C. For simplicity I'm going to call the creature being asked about the Texas Chupacabra, to differentiate it from the other creature dubbed the Chupacabra that was first reported in Puerto Rico in 1995. To directly answer the question, yes, there is some validity to some of the Texas Chupacabra sightings. Heck, I'd even say to most of them. the garage kingWebA group network in Texas for sharing information & resources about Cryptozoology, ranging from basic animal zoology studies to abnormal wildlife research and strange encounters … the american society for testing materials
